New Audiobooks In The Google Book Knowledge Cards

Now if you search on your mobile device for a book, if there is an audio version of that book, let's say on Audible, Google will let you click on that as an option to get the book. Most recently, Google added libraries as an option to get the book but now they linked up with Audible to bring the book to you via audio.

This seems to only work on mobile, for example, here is Hillary Clinton's new book:

Google Audio Books

Notice the Audible option as well as a way to filter to see this book available as an "Audiobooks"?
